30th Anniversary Commemor<strong>at</strong>ive Quilt Project<br />

To help celebr<strong>at</strong>e the 30th<br />

Anniversary of <strong>Ronald</strong> <strong>McDonald</strong><br />

<strong>House</strong> <strong>at</strong> <strong>Stanford</strong>, white cotton<br />

squares were mailed to all families<br />

who stayed <strong>at</strong> the <strong>House</strong> for whom we<br />

had addresses. Over 160 decor<strong>at</strong>ed<br />

squares were returned. With the help of several<br />

quilting stores and numerous volunteers, three<br />

quilts have been assembled and two additional<br />

quilts are due to be completed.<br />

Each quilt square was accompanied by a<br />

short profile about the person on it. In many<br />

cases, the squares and notes were touching<br />

memorials to children who have passed away.<br />

But, we also received a tremendous number of<br />
